Powerful Sailor Quotes and Their Meanings

Here are some powerful sailor quotes, analyzed for their deeper meaning and relevance to everyday life:

"The sea, once it casts its spell, holds one in its net of wonder forever." – Jacques Cousteau

This quote speaks to the captivating power of pursuing a passion. Just as the sea captivates sailors, our passions can draw us in completely, shaping our lives and providing a sense of purpose. It encourages us to embrace those things that ignite our curiosity and inspire us to push our boundaries, even if the path is challenging.

"A smooth sea never made a skillful sailor." – English Proverb

This proverb highlights the importance of overcoming challenges to achieve growth and mastery. Life's calm periods are essential, but it's the storms that truly test our resilience and refine our skills. Embracing difficulties, rather than avoiding them, helps us develop the strength and wisdom to navigate future obstacles. It's a reminder that comfort zones rarely lead to significant personal development.

What Makes a Good Sailor? (and What Makes a Good Life)

The qualities that make a successful sailor often translate into the qualities that make for a successful and fulfilling life. These include:

  • Adaptability: Sailors must constantly adjust to changing weather conditions and unexpected events. This translates into a need for flexibility and resilience in life.
  • Problem-solving skills: Navigating the open sea often presents complex problems that require creative solutions. This skill is crucial in tackling life's challenges.
  • Teamwork: Sailing, particularly on larger vessels, relies heavily on cooperation and communication. Effective teamwork is crucial for navigating life's complexities.
  • Patience and Persistence: Long voyages require endurance, perseverance, and the ability to withstand setbacks. These traits are essential for achieving long-term goals.
  • Resourcefulness: Sailors must be able to improvise and make do with limited resources. This skill is valuable in overcoming unexpected obstacles in life.
